Overall, the food at Luna Pizza Café was good and authentic. The atmosphere was nice and comfortable. The specific spot they... were in was a bit difficult to find and so was finding proper parking. There were not really any signs pointing or signaling inthe direction of where parking for Luna was at. The staff were helpful and very knowledgeable about the menu. The overall themeof the restaurant was a little hard to pinpoint but did have some artisanal and rustic tones. It seemed to be a higher-end,casual setting and not overwhelming. My appetizer, the fire roasted chicken drumsticks, was underwhelming with flavor past theskin. All our food was hot, fresh, and looked appetizing. They even have an open area where you can see the pizzas being made.The ingredients are fresh and quality. However, I did think that they were a little overpriced for what you are getting. Iordered a build your own pizza with a couple of toppings and the size of the pizza is good. It was more than enough for 1person, but not exactly enough to share. My dessert was amazing. I ordered the Panna Cotta but was addressed by the manager thatit was not ready to be served. So instead, I got the Cannoli and they were so delicious and light. I will definitely bereturning!
